2 - 2
Purpose
Operation test/check
Function
(Purpose)
Used to check the operation of sensors and detectors in the RADF/ADF/SPF units and the related circuit.
Section
SPF/ADF/RADF/UDH
Item
Operation
Operation/
Procedure
The operations of sensors and detectors in the RADF/ADF/SPFsection are displayed.
The active sensors and detectors are highlighted.

2 - 3
Purpose
Operation test/check
Function
(Purpose)
Used to check the operation of the loads in the RADF/ADF/SPF units and the control circuits.
Section
ADF/RADF/UDH/SPF
Item
Operation
Operation/
Procedure
1. The names of the loads which can be operated are displayed. Select the load to be checked with the key, and the
selected load is highlighted.
2. Press the [EXECUTE] key.
The load selected in procedure 1 starts the operation. During the operation of the load, the [EXECUTE] key is
highlighted. If the EXECUTE key is pressed while it is highlighted, the operation is stopped.
When two or more operations are selected in procedure 1, the operation is performed in the sequence of display
order.
